
Happy Pi Button Switch Box
thingiverse
A quick build for two colorful round tactile button switches from Adafruit, product id 1009. I wanted a single physical button for turning both my Octopi and Ender on and off without just killing power to my pi. It now first runs a shutdown on my pi to prevent corruption. I could only figure a way to do it with it two buttons though, one for off, on gpio pin 26 with GPIO Shutdown, and the other for on, on gpio pin 3*. It's open in the back because it sits right against the printer. I shared the Tinkercad, it should be easy to re-edit for more buttons. Edit it online https://www.tinkercad.com/things/8ZPGq8W9Jbq The switch's model I found here: https://www.thingiverse.com/thing:493721 The Ender is on a TP-link, controlled by the Pi with this plugin: https://plugins.octoprint.org/plugins/tplinksmartplug/ *Still have to disconnect power to ensure it doesn't turn back on because only a minor voltage shift will trip pin 3 to turn on power.
